Week 6 MVP: Dontaye Draper, Cedevita
Dontaye Draper - Cedevita Zagreb (photo kkcedevita.hr)A brilliant performance with his team’s season on the line from Cedevita playmaker Dontaye Draper not only lifted his team to victory and the Last 16, but landed him Eurocup Week 6 MVP honors and cemented his arrival as one of the top young guards in Europe. Draper poured in 32 points on 9-of-14 two-point and 3-of-6 three-point shooting in addition to 5 rebounds, 7 assists and just 1 turnover as Cedevita turned away BC Azovmash 88-84. His 36 performance index rating marked the fifth game in a row that Draper improved that stat and allowed Draper to finish the regular season among the league leaders in index, scoring, assists and steals. Draper’s index was actually the second best among the final regular season games, however the top individual performer, Primoz Brezec of Krasnye Krylia, was not eligible as his team lost its Week 6 game against Alba Berlin. Nevertheless Brezec shined with 23 points, 17 rebounds and 3 assists for a 40 index. Third on the list of top Week 6 performers was GasTerra Flames guard Matt Bauscher after he tallied 18 points, 7 rebounds, 6 assists and 4 steals for a 34 index in a home loss against Panellinios. Draper’s teammate and the beneficiary of a number of his assists, big man Corsley Edwards, and Besiktas ColaTurka power forward Cevher Ozer round out the list of top showings with 32 indexes. Edwards scored 22 points and grabbed 9 boards for Cedevita. Ozer amassed 27 points and 7 boards in a 91-86 win over BG Goettingen.

Individual highs: Primoz Brezec of Krasnye Krylia, 17 rebounds

Draper’s 32-point scoring outburst was the best of any player in Week 6. He raised his scoring averaged to 17.8 points per game, placing him sixth in the regular season. Brezec bids farewell to the competition as its No. 1 scorer with 20.8 points per game. Brezec leaves as the No. 2 rebounder after his haul of 17 boards in the regular season finale - the most of any player – lifted him to 9.7 per game. PAOK center Lazaros Papadopoulos finished as the top rebounder with 12.2 per game. Goettingen point guard Trent Meacham was the Week 6 leader with 11 assists. He raised his average to 6.2 per game, which trailed only Gal Mekel’s 6.3 for Hapoel Gilboa/Galil. Two players – Vladimir Veremeenko of Unics Kazan and Kristaps Janicenoks of VEF Riga – swiped 6 steals in Week 6, the most in the Eurocup. Janicenoks’s 2.5 steals per game were tied for third-most in the competition. Draper finished as the regular season’s steals leader with 2.8 per game. Galatasaray Café Crown forward Rado Rancik and Le Mans big man Thierry Rupert both rejected 3 shots in Week 6. Rupert ranked fifth in the Eurocup with 1.3 per game. Jerusalem forward Brian Randle’s 2.3 blocks per game were the most in the regular season. Six players tallied double-doubles in the final game of the regular season: Brezec, Papadopoulos (14 points, 10 rebounds), Joe Krabbenhoft (11 points, 14 rebounds) of Panellinios, Boris Davovic (16 points, 10 rebounds) of Hemofarm Stada, Zach Morley of Budivelnik (13 points, 10 rebounds) and Denis Marconato (12 points, 10 rebounds) of Bennet Cantu.
